Many new points in the management of food safety

VCN- According to Decree 15/2018 / ND-CP replacing Decree No. 38/2012 / ND-CP guiding some articles of the Law on Food Safety promulgated by the Government and effective from 2nd February 2018, the management of food safety will have many changes, facilitating enterprises.

Under Decree 15, the management of food safety will be scientific and convinient to enterprises

Director General of Food Safety Department under the Ministry of Health Nguyen Thanh Phong said that the new Decree detailing the implementation of a number of articles of the Law on Food Safety is developed towards significantly cutting procedures of registration, announcement and specialized inspection of food, transferring from pre-inspection to post- inspection. This adjustment is to create convenient legal corridors and maximum favourable conditions for enterprises, but still on the basis of taking the people's health as a top priority.

The first new point in the decree according to the director of Food Safety Department is that enterprises are permitted to self-announce their products and are responsible under the law for that announcement, rather than sending the records of announcement to the state agencies for certification, excepting some products which must be announced at the Ministry of Health and the Department of Health.

Specifically, Health food, compound food additives with new usage will be registered for the announcement at the Food Safety Department under the Ministry of Health; Nutritional products for children up to 36 months of age will be registered for the announcement at the local health department; and the remaining products shall be announced by enterprises under the instruction.

According to the announcement of enterprises, the state management agencies will strengthen post-inspection, inspection and sanctions for violations, in which expanding the scope and raising the level of sanctions in accordance with the law. In particular, there are some items exempt from announcement.

According to the above regulation, under the calculations by the Central Institute for Economic Management, about 95% of food products are exempt from administrative procedures. If this is carried out strictly, 1.8 million working days and more than VND 600 billion shall be saved.

The second point of the Decree is the change in the regulations on production and business conditions to ensure food safety and approach to global management methods. This is an expansion of the enterprises which do not need a certificate of eligibility for food safety as well as an expansion of enterprises which are exempt from a certificate of eligibility for food safety.

Accordingly, the initial small production establishment, initial processing establishments, restaurants, food stores, etc., will not have to apply for certificate of eligibility for food safety and have right to self announce and take responsibility. "All of these new regulations aim to minimize administrative procedures. However, in order to effectively implement the regulations while ensuring the food safety and hygiene, there will be a strict decentralization for local authorities," Phong stressed.

This Decree also specifies foods that must be registered for their contents before being advertised as food for health protection, nutritional food for medical purposes, food for special diet; nutritional products for children up to 36 months of age not subject to band from advertisement in Article 7 of the Advertising Law.

On the assignment of responsibility for state management of food safety, the Decree clarifies the management responsibilities of the three ministries, including Health, Industry and Trade, Agriculture and Rural Development in the direction that the ministries are in absolute charge of management of commodity groups

For some enterprises producing many kinds of food products under the management jurisdiction of two or more ministries, the ministry which manages the product with the largest quantity will be in charge of those enterprises.
